(1)Vertical Hydraulic System

(2)Horizontal Hydraulic System


(3)Side Mounting Hydraulic System

The side mounting hydraulic pump station, that is, the oil pump device, is horizontally installed on the basis of a separate tank, and the side type can be equipped with a spare pump, which is mainly used for the system with a large mailbox capacity of 250 liters and an electric power of 7.5KW or more.

How To Release Pressure On Hydraulic System?

Releasing pressure from a hydraulic system is an essential procedure to ensure the safe maintenance, repair, or disconnection of hydraulic components. Here are the general steps to release pressure in a hydraulic system:

  1. Shut Down the Power:
    • Turn off the power supply to the hydraulic system. This step is crucial to prevent any accidental activation of hydraulic components during the pressure release process.
  2. Identify Pressure Sources:
    • Identify the components or circuits in the hydraulic system that are under pressure. This includes hydraulic cylinders, accumulators, or any other pressurized components.
  3. Release Pressure Gradually:
    • Locate the pressure relief valve in the hydraulic system. It is typically present in the hydraulic pump or control valve assembly.
    • Slowly open the pressure relief valve to release the pressure. This valve is designed to allow controlled release of hydraulic fluid and reduce system pressure to a safe level.
    • Depending on the system design, the pressure relief valve may be adjusted manually or operated automatically through a control mechanism.
  4. Bleed Hydraulic Components:
    • After releasing the system pressure, it is essential to bleed any trapped hydraulic fluid from the components. This step ensures that there is no residual pressure or trapped fluid that can cause unexpected movement or fluid leakage.
  5. Follow Manufacturer Recommendations:
    • Always refer to the specific manufacturer’s instructions and safety guidelines for the hydraulic system you are working on. Different hydraulic systems may have variations in the pressure release procedure or additional steps depending on their design and specifications.
